Performance advantages of carbon dioxide capture agents:
Carbon dioxide capture agents are widely used in the adsorption and removal of carbon dioxide in industrial waste gas treatment, air purification, and gas purification fields. They have the characteristics of large adsorption capacity, fast adsorption rate, easy regeneration, simple operation, and long service life.
The performance advantages of carbon dioxide capture agents are also evident, as they can maintain a high carbon dioxide adsorption capacity over a wide temperature range; The adsorption and desorption processes are rapid and suitable for continuous operation; It has strong durability, good mechanical strength and chemical stability, and a long service life; Adsorption performance can be restored through simple thermal or steam regeneration methods, making it easy to regenerate; The adsorption process is non-toxic, harmless, and meets environmental protection requirements.
Instructions for using carbon dioxide capture agents:
1.Pre treatment: Clean the resin with deionized water to remove any impurities that may have been introduced during transportation. As needed, sodium hydroxide solution can be used for pretreatment to ensure that the resin is in optimal working condition;
2.Adsorption operation: Load the pre treated resin into the adsorption tower or reactor, allowing the gas containing carbon dioxide to pass through the resin bed for carbon dioxide adsorption. Monitor the carbon dioxide concentration at the inlet and outlet of the resin bed to determine if the resin has reached saturation.
3.Regeneration operation: When the resin reaches saturation, stop air intake and close the adsorption tower. Hot air or steam is used to desorb the adsorbed carbon dioxide through the resin bed, and the regenerated resin can be reused.
